Build It! Make It! SPACE by Rob Ives

The fourth book in our best-selling Build it! Make it! series …Space! Rob Ives is a genius at engineering models that move, entertain and give hours and hours of fun for everyone. Imagine making a top-secret spy satellite, cosmic fans will love this book. All you need are some simple items and the step-by-step instructions will be easy to follow. Get ready to build….  Spacecraft that can land on the Moon A spectacular space station to orbit the Earth Awesome rockets ready for lift off  Spy satellites, for a top-secret project!   Use the QR Codes to download templates and see videos of finished models. Spectacular facts complete each project. It’s the best book for kids to join the space race and become super engineers!
Rob Ives is a designer and paper engineer living in Cumbria, UK. He started designing models from cardboard as a maths and science teacher, and made a career change when he was asked to create two books of models. His published titles include Paper Models that Rock!Amazing Paper Petsand Paper Automata. He specializes in character-based paper animations and all kinds of fun and fascinating paper projects, and often visits schools to talk about design technology and demonstrate his models.
